Vcl.ExtActns.TListControlDeleteSelection

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

Vcl.ExtActns.TListControlActionVcl.ActnList.TCustomActionSystem.Actions.TContainedActionSystem.Classes.TBasicActionSystem.Classes.TComponentSystem.Classes.TPersistentTListControlDeleteSelection

Delphi

TListControlDeleteSelection = class(TListControlAction)

C++

class PASCALIMPLEMENTATION TListControlDeleteSelection : public TListControlAction

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
class public
Vcl.ExtActns.pas
Vcl.ExtActns.hpp
Vcl.ExtActns Vcl.ExtActns

Beschreibung

TListControlDeleteSelection löscht die in einem Listenfeld oder einer Listenansicht ausgewählten Elemente.

Wenn Sie einer Aktionsliste ein TListControlDeleteSelection-Objekt hinzufügen, kann der Benutzer in einem Listenfeld oder einer Listenansicht alle ausgewählten Einträge löschen, indem er auf einen Menüeintrag oder eine Schaltfläche klickt. Steuerelemente, die mit dieser Aktion verknüpft sind, veranlassen die Anwendung, im Zielobjekt alle ausgewählten Einträge zu löschen.

Das Zielobjekt von TListControlDeleteSelection sollte immer ein Listenfeld oder eine Listenansicht sein (d.h. ein Nachkomme von TCustomListControl). Ist diese Voraussetzung nicht erfüllt oder im Zielobjekt kein Eintrag ausgewählt, deaktiviert sich TListControlDeleteSelection automatisch selbst.

Siehe auch